Thursday, March 19, 2020

Statistics mysql

What is a table in MySQL? How to update data in MySQL? How do I create tables in MySQL? Information about table indexes is also available from the SHOW INDEX statement.


Part explores key performance statistics in MySQL , and Part explains how to set up MySQL monitoring in Datadog.

Table statistics are based on value groups, where a value group is a set of rows with the same key prefix value. The STATISTICS table provides information about table indexes. The SQL Server Query Optimizer uses this statistical information to estimate the cardinality, or number of rows, in the query result to be returne which enables the SQL Server Query Optimizer to create a high-quality query execution plan. The statistics provide information about the distribution of column values across participating rows, helping the optimizer better estimate the number of rows, or cardinality, of the query. The query optimizer will use parallel sample statistics , whenever a table size exceeds a certain threshold.


An SQL developer must decide what type of data that will be stored inside each column when creating a table. The data type is a guideline for SQL to understand what type of data is expected inside of each column, and it also identifies how SQL will interact with the stored data. When the data in the database changes the statistics become stale and outdated.

When examining a query execution plan, a large discrepancy between the Actual Number of Rows and the Estimated Number of Rows is an indication of outdated stats. Outdated statistics can lead the optimizer in choosing. To date ( mysql .18) there is no suitable function inside mysql to re-create indexes. So, if we can collect execution plans for some.


Practice with our example. The preceding image shows the Initializr with Maven chosen as the build tool. It also shows values of com. You can also use Gradle. Group and Artifact, respectively.


SET STATISTICS IO displays statistics on the amount of disk activity generated by the query. By writing a query a few different ways you can compare the statistics and determine the best statement to deploy to production. PackageReference Include= MySql. SQL ( Structured Query Language ) is a programming language designed for managing data in a relational database.


SQL has a variety of functions that allow its users to rea manipulate, and change data. This page will help with that. MySQL Cluster is a real-time open source transactional database designed for fast, always-on access to data under high throughput conditions.


In this blog post, we will have a look at how you can create histogram statistics , and we will explain when it might be useful to have histogram statistics.

The following list shows the common numeric data types and their descriptions − INT − A normal-sized integer that can be signed or unsigned. The SQL ( structured query language ) programming language is often used to pull data from the various tables in a database and to assemble the data in a format amenable to statistical analysis or review. The purpose of this course is to teach you how to extract data from a relational database using SQL so you can perform statistical operations.


Summary: updating data is one of the most important tasks when you work with the database. In this tutorial, you will learn how to use the MySQL UPDATE statement to update data in a table. SQL Data Type is an attribute that specifies the type of data of any object. Each column, variable and expression has a related data type in SQL.


I Structured Query Language I Usually “talk” to a database server I Used as front end to many databases ( mysql , postgresql, oracle, sybase) I Three Subsystems: data description, data access and privileges I Optimized for certain data arrangements I The language is case-sensitive, but I use upper case for keywords. Insert Data Only in Specified Columns. It is also possible to only insert data in specific columns.

No comments:

Post a Comment

Note: Only a member of this blog may post a comment.

Popular Posts